Understanding the Benefits of Multiple Tooth Implants
Multiple tooth implants offer a reliable and long-lasting solution for individuals who have lost several teeth. Unlike dentures or bridges, implants provide a stable foundation by anchoring directly into the jawbone. This not only helps maintain bone density but also multiple tooth implants ensures improved chewing ability and speech clarity. Patients with multiple tooth implants often experience a boost in confidence, as these implants look and feel like natural teeth, making everyday activities more comfortable and enjoyable.
What to Expect During the Implant Procedure
The process of receiving multiple tooth implants involves several steps, starting with a thorough dental examination and imaging to assess the jawbone’s condition. Once the dentist confirms suitability, the implants are surgically placed into the jawbone. After a healing period, during emergency toothache relief which the implants fuse with the bone, the restorative crowns or bridges are attached. This procedure requires careful planning and precision to ensure the implants align properly and provide a natural bite and appearance.
